Some 1,529 unique dwell turtles valued at greater than £65,750 have been discovered smuggled into the Philippines in a passenger’s baggage.
The reptiles have been found by customs officers at Terminal 2 of Ninoy Aquino Worldwide Airport in Manila.
They’d been packed in 4 suitcases and travelled the two-hour journey from Hong Kong on Philippine Airways’ flight PR 311.

The baggage have been deserted on the airport and, when opened, contained a 1,500-strong assortment of unique and uncommon turtles, together with the star tortoise, redfoot tortoise, sulcata tortoise and red-eared slider species.
The Customs NAIA crew uploaded footage of the turtles on Fb, some which confirmed the animals certain with duct tape.
“Unlawful Wildlife Buying and selling is a violation of RA 10863 (Customs Modernization and Tariff Act) and RA 9147 (Wildlife Assets Conservation and Safety Act),” the bureau wrote in an accompanying submit.

“Violators might face imprisonment of 1 yr and at some point to 2 years and a high-quality of 20,000 pesos (£293) to 200,000 pesos (£2,925).”
The submit concluded: “BOC NAIA will repeatedly defend the borders towards importation and exportation of unlawful wildlife commerce and different prohibited and anti-social items.”
In 2018, the customs bureau mentioned it had discovered 560 animals, together with endangered species, smuggled into the Philippines.

These included 250 geckos and 254 corals.
In 2019, 63 iguanas, chameleons and bearded dragons have already been intercepted.
The incident follows a narrative reported by The Impartial in January, when officers at Berlin Schönefeld airport found a suspicious bundle inside a passenger’s pants – a boa snake.
The 43-year-old man was trying to go via customs on his approach to Israel when he was apprehended by safety employees, who found the reptile hid in his underwear.
Border police have been known as, who made the person take away the unlikely parcel from his underwear. He proceeded to provide a small material bag containing the 40cm lengthy serpent.
